Dr. Jainaba Jallow
Dr. Jainaba Jallow is a prominent mental health advocate in The Gambia, known for her significant contributions to the establishment of the National Mental Health Taskforce, which aims to improve mental health awareness and services in the country. Her efforts were pivotal in organizing The Gambia's first National Mental Health Awareness Week in October 2025 and in validating the Mental Health Policy 2025, which focuses on anti-stigma campaigns and expanding access to mental health care. Dr. Jallow's work continues to influence mental health policy and practice, fostering a national dialogue on mental health issues.
